November 24, 2008 - At RSNA 2008, RCG Healthcare Consulting its new Illumarad: Physician Productivity, a Web-based, subscription physician productivity tool.

Illumarad: Physician Productivity analyzes productivity measures, ranks performance versus internal and external benchmarks and predicts appropriate radiologist staffing levels.

OncoView adds to Varian's product lines for cancer clinics that offer advanced forms of image-guided radiotherapy and radiosurgery. The platform integrates the viewing, managing, storing and archiving of oncology images and data, supporting workflow specific to oncology throughout each phase of cancer treatment, from initial diagnosis to treatment response and to survivorship.

Varian Medical Systems' PaxScan line consists of flat panels for digital radiography together with its full line of detectors for filmless imaging.

- The 4336R, a 14 x 17 inch detector designed to replace standard film cassettes used in radiographic applications, is intended for use in mobile and multi-bucky imaging systems.

- The 4343R, Varian’s largest panel at 17 x 17 inches, is designed for permanent mounting in radiographic tables or wall stands, or for any application that requires a large field of view.

November 21, 2008 – Medical imaging specialist Barco has entered into an agreement to sell its advanced visualization business to Toshiba Medical Systems Corp., Tokyo, Japan (Toshiba) via its newly formed, wholly-owned subsidiary, Toshiba Medical Visualization Systems Europe Ltd., Edinburgh, UK (TMVS).

November 21, 2008 - Agfa HealthCare will showcase its web-based enterprise scheduling and planning solution, IMPAX Scheduling, at RSNA this year.

With healthcare delivery becoming increasingly complex, the solution is designed to help hospitals and clinics of all sizes increase productivity by efficiently managing study orders, patient appointments and resources in a real-time, web based application. IMPAX Scheduling delivers increased resource efficiency at a very low time-to-schedule.

CIVCO Medical Solutions’ CT Guidance Device is an inexpensive hand-held device designed to increase the speed, accuracy and safety of CT guided procedures. It is designed to improve first pass accuracy for either traditional vertical plane or more difficult angled plane procedures, such as aspiration/biopsy, drainage or ablation.
